Comparison of medication adherence between type 2 diabetes mellitus patients who pay for their medications and those who receive it free: a rural Asian experience.
Devarajan RathishRuvini HemachandraThilini PremadasaSasini RamanayakeChathuri RasangikaRavi RoshibanChanna JayasumanaPublished in: Journal of health, population, and nutrition (2019)
There was no significant difference in medication adherence between the universal-free group and fee-paying group, despite of having a significantly different income. The universal-free health service would be a probable reason.
